Hi There Everyone Carol Timlin and I are having a Weekend of Song and Music and Verse with any 'profits' going to Macmillan Cancer Support - still a few rooms left in the hotel and spaces for campervans/motorhomes. Full details as below:-

Spring Sing in aid of Macmillan Cancer Support from Friday, 25 March 2011 at 19:30 – Sunday, 27 March 2011 at 23:30 at the Croxdale Inn, Front Street,Croxdale, Co. Durham - Croxdale is near Durham City

A DIY weekend with some themes and fines e.g. finger in the ear would mean a £1 fine! At least!!
Some places for motorhomes but we would prefer you reserve places in advance. Sorry no facilities for tents - probably a bit cold then anyway.
En suite rooms are £100 PER ROOM for the three nights i.e. £33.33 per night. A deposit of £50 will secure a room for the 3 nights.
Hoping to raise some money for Macmillan Cancer Support and generally to have a good weekend of Folk Song and Music and Verse.
